- Pixelmator
Platforms: Mac and iOS only
Price: $29.99 for Mac and $4.99 for iOS
If you are looking for something cheaper than Photoshop but brings out the same quality, the Pixelmator would be an excellent choice. Pixelmator allows us to turn any photo into art in just a few clicks. This software is an ideal product for indie designers to make their games. However, it is built exclusively for Mac and iOS devices. Last 2011, it received the Apple Design Award for the App of the Year and Best of Mac App Store.
In designing, you can use your Apple Pencil to illustrate more precision in retouching, painting, and drawing. With Pixelmator, you will enjoy the real powerhouse of Mac OS, including the Core Image, OpenGL, OpenCL, Grand Central Dispatch, and 64-bit architecture.
- GIMP
Platforms: Windows, Mac, Solaris, BSD, Linus
Price: Free
GNU Image Manipulation Program, also known as GIMP, is a famous cross-platform image editor that is ideal for design with limited budgets. With this software, you can quickly turn any images into masterpieces. It has a wide variety of tools that can bring your ideas into life.
Moreover, this software supports several third-party plugins and programming languages. If you are the developer and designer of the game, GIMP could be a helpful tool in your arsenal. It has the same features as Adobe Photoshop. However, with this software, you can achieve a seamless tile for games, which is difficult to achieve in Photoshop.
- Inkscape
Platforms: Windows, Mac, Linux
Price: Free
Another worth-considering software in graphic design for game development is Inkscape. This software allows us to create vector-based images without paying for anything. Inkscape is an excellent tool for developers who are building 2D games. With Inkscape, you can develop 2D characters, objects, and environmental elements like trees or mountains. In exporting your layout, you can save it as S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ics) or PNG to ensure the high resolution.
- Marmoset Hexels
Platforms: Mac and Windows
Price $49.00
If you want to develop a pixel-themed game, then the Marmoset Hexels is the ideal tool for you. Most game developers said that Marmoset Hexels has everything they need. This software is a creative suite of animation, grid-based painting, and design. Its built-in geometric canvas grid allows us to create any pixel style art regardless if we are beginners or professionals. This software is available for both Windows and Mac. It only costs $49.00.
